The Fenestration and Glazing Industry Alliance (FGIA) has released several updated documents for recommended test methods for three types of movement during seismic events.
- AAMA 501.4, Recommended test method for lateral inter-story movements (drift).
- AAMA 501.6, Recommended dynamic test method for determining the seismic lateral inter-story movement causing glass fallout.
- AAMA 501.7, Recommended test method for vertical inter-story movements.
AAMA 501.4 provides a means of evaluating the performance of windows, window wall, curtain wall, and storefront systems when subjected to specified horizontal displacements in the plane of the wall.
AAMA 501.6 provides a means of determining the horizontal racking displacement amplitude of exterior wall system framing members that would cause the fallout of representative architectural glass panels under controlled laboratory conditions.
AAMA 501.7 provides a means of evaluating the performance of windows, window wall, curtain wall, and storefront wall systems when subjected to specified vertical displacements.
The most important change is that all three documents are now aligned with one another, explained Winco Window Company’s Lothar Erkens, who serves as vice chair of the FGIA Seismic and Wind-Induced Inter-Story Drift Review Task Group.
“While AAMA 501.4 and 501.6 were split from a single document into two documents for a good reason, the need to keep these texts aligned with each other was important,” said Erkens.
